Anti-Bribery, Sanctions & AML Screening

Economic sanctions, bribery, and money-laundering risk are consolidated into a single financial-crime category — with known deal-killer phrases forced to the top of the score, even if the surrounding language is softer.

What it screens for

  • OFAC/SDN sanctions exposure — named parties or jurisdictions appearing on sanctions lists.
  • FCPA and anti-bribery risk — kickback schemes, improper payments, and corruption indicators.
  • Anti-money-laundering (AML) red flags in transaction structures and counterparties.
  • Critical-phrase floors — specific phrases (e.g. an SDN list hit, a disclosed sanctions breach, or an FCPA violation) force a high severity score even when an LLM's own summary language softens the finding.
  • Negation-aware reading — a resolved or explicitly ruled-out sanctions concern is scored down instead of triggering a false floor.

Why it's consolidated and blocking

Economic sanctions and AML are scored together under this one category rather than split across Legal or Supply Chain — financial-crime risk has a distinct legal exposure profile from general litigation or supply-chain concentration risk, and keeping it in one place avoids diluting the signal.

A score of 70 or higher here halts the deal for mandatory review, the same as Financial, Legal, HR/Labour, IP & Licensing, Regulatory/Merger Control, and AI & Tech Governance.
